通过React网页认证React Native用户可以通过以下步骤实现:
- 创建一个React网页应用程序,可以使用React框架和相关技术(如React Router)来构建用户界面。
- 在React网页应用程序中,实现用户认证功能,可以使用第三方认证库(如Passport.js)来简化认证流程。
- 在用户认证过程中,可以使用常见的认证方法,如用户名和密码、社交媒体登录(如Facebook、Google)或单点登录(SSO)等。
- 在React Native应用程序中,使用WebView组件加载React网页应用程序,以便用户可以在应用程序中进行认证。
- 在React Native应用程序中,使用React Native的通信机制(如WebView的onMessage事件)与加载的React网页应用程序进行交互,以便在认证过程中传递数据和接收认证结果。
- 在React网页应用程序中,认证成功后,可以将认证结果返回给React Native应用程序,并执行相应的操作(如导航到受保护的页面)。
- 在React Native应用程序中,根据认证结果,可以更新用户界面,显示认证成功或失败的信息。
推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云认证服务(https://cloud.tencent.com/product/cas)
- 腾讯云移动应用开发平台(https://cloud.tencent.com/product/madp)
请注意,以上答案仅供参考,具体实现方式可能因具体需求和技术选择而有所不同。